This is Day Twenty-Six of 3650 Minutes of Prayer. Today, we meditate on the profound promise of Psalm 23: that YHWH restores our soul. We recognize that this restoration is not merely for our comfort, but for His name’s sake. He is leading us back to the original glory and the likeness we held in the beginning in a state of perfect alignment with His will.We are reminded that as the Farmer prunes the branch to ensure it bears more fruit, the Lord prunes our lives to reveal the "new creature" within. In Christ, the old has passed away and every single thing has become of God. We yield to the Great Shepherd, trusting that even the paths of discipline are paths of righteousness that manifest His glory through us.We now yield to this presence in prayer. We open our hearts to the immersion of the Father, asking that the Life of The Son flows through us.
